SMGIX vs. CDAZX
SMGIX (Columbia Contrarian Core Fund) and CDAZX (Multi-Manager Directional Alternative Strategies Fund) are both mutual funds - SMGIX is a Large Cap Blend Equities fund managed by Columbia, while CDAZX is a Long-Short fund managed by Columbia. Over the past 5 years, SMGIX returned 13.42%/yr vs 11.00%/yr for CDAZX. A 0.74 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. SMGIX charges 0.75%/yr vs 1.84%/yr for CDAZX.
